I grew up in a little central Texas town that had two rivers which ran 
through it.  Much of my youth was spent on a river bank with a fishing pole 
in my hand.  I'd sometimes fish for catfish which are bottom feeders.  Any 
that have watched my ebay action know I do a little bottom feeding myself 
from time to time.  The Tamron 180mm f2.5 was $285, the 300mm f2.8 with 
teleconverter was $820 and truly LN and the prize of the bunch was the 400mm 
f4 at about $570 after figuring in the CLA I had done after I bought it. It 
was in nice condition other than for the insect which had somehow worked 
itself inside the lens, died and the partially fallen apart.  So that is a 
little under $1700 for the three, not a Fang, but not bad either.  I agree 
the 300 & 400 together would be a real pain to carry unless it was a short 
distance to a blind of staging area.  The 180mm has been glued on the front 
of one of my OM 2S bodies for several weeks now and I have been tempted by 
the 80-200mm f2.8.  When I find one at the right price, I'll probably have to 
make room for it in the stash closet.  Bill Barber
